signal: Initial version of role

This commit is contained in:
Timo Mäkinen 2025-03-13 19:43:58 +02:00
parent b9a2d06df0
commit 23e02b6045
2 changed files with 20 additions and 0 deletions

2
signal/defaults/main.yml Normal file
View file

@ -0,0 +1,2 @@
---
signal_baseurl: https://download.opensuse.org/repositories/network:/im:/signal

18
signal/tasks/main.yml Normal file
View file

@ -0,0 +1,18 @@
---
- name: Enable repository
ansible.builtin.yum_repository:
name: signal
baseurl: "{{ signal_baseurl }}/Fedora_{{ ansible_distribution_version }}"
description: Signal Messaging Devel Project
gpgcheck: true
gpgkey: >-
{{
signal_baseurl + "/Fedora_" + ansible_distribution_version +
"/repodata/repomd.xml.key"
}}
enabled: true
- name: Install Signal
ansible.builtin.package:
name: signal-desktop
state: present